Comments on the ownership information

  • CRA LTD. SOLD 100% OF COBAR MINES LTD. TO VOTRAINT NO. 724 PTY. LTD. WHICH IS IN TURN OWNED BY A CONSORTIUM LED BY GOLDEN SHAMROCK MINES LTD. AND PACIFIC ROAD SECURITIES PTY. LTD.

General comments

Subject category Comment text
Deposit COBAR MINES PROPIETARY LTD PRODUCES CU ZN PB BY MINING UNDERGROUND WITH A 3 SHAFT OPEN-STOPING MECHANIZED CUT AND FILL METHOD USING HAULAGE TRUCKS AND BELTS TO TRANSPORT THE ORE. THE MINE OPENED IN 1965. ACTUAL TONNAGE IS 658,130 METRIC TONS. MINERALIZATION OCCURS AS COPPER,LEAD,ZINC AND IRON SULFIDES. DAILY ORE CAPACITY EQUALS DAILY MILL CAPACITY AT 2500 TPD THE EXTRACTION METHOD IS FLOTATION. THE GENERAL MANAGER OF THE OPERATION IS J.T.BRADY. DURING THE YEAR ENDING JUNE 1969 626,530 MT OF COPPER AND COPPER/ZINC ORE WERE RAISED FROM THE MINE. 186,478 MT OF COPPER/ZINC ORE WERE TREATED ASSAYING 1.2% COPPER AND 4.7% ZINC AND 1.8% LEAD. 3839 MT OF PB CONC WERE PRODUCED CONTAINING 47.1% LEAD. ALL THE PB CONC WAS SMELTED TO BULLION AT COCKLE CREEK. IN ADDITION 44,296 MT OF CU CONC. AND 11395 MT OF ZINC CONC. WERE RECOVERED. THE MINE IS OPERATING WITH ADEQUATE PROVEN RESERVES THEREFORE NO EXPLORATION IS NEEDED. TOTAL CAPITAL COST FOR THE MINE IS $28 MILLION. COPPER CONCENTRATES ARE ASSUMED TO BE SENT TO THE ELECTROLYTIC REFINING AND SMELTING CO. OF AUSTRALIA LTD. AT PORT KEMBLA,NEW WALES BY TRAIN (760 KM.). THE NO.1 SHAFT WAS EXTENDED FROM 397M TO 1006M IN 1974. THE NO.2 SHAFT WOULD HAVE TO BE EXTENDED FROM 618M TO 1006M IN 1981 TO PREPARE FOR MINING THE ORE BETWEEN THE 540M LEVEL AND THE 1006M LEVEL. DRIFTS,RAISES,STOPES, AND CORE DRILLINGWOULD ALSO NEED TO BE DEVELOPED IN 1981. MINING BEGAN IN JUNE OF 1965 AT C.S.A. AND THEREFORE THE EQUIPMENT WAS REPLACED IN 1974. THE ORIGINAL MINE PLANT IS ADEQUATE FOR CONTINUED MINING. AS OF JANUARY 1,1981 RECOVERABLE RESOURCE AT 75% POB- ABILITY IS 26,647,498 MT,ASUMING OPEN STOPE UNDERGROUND MINING. 500,000 MT OF ORE ARE MINED THE FIRST 5 YRS,AND 700,000 MT OF ORE WILL BE MINED THEREAFTER. THE MINE OPERATES 260 DAYS PER YEAR. MINE AND MILL OPERATING COST IS $24.59/MT. THE MILL OP COST IS $8.30/MT. COPPER SMELTER OPERATING CHARGE AS OF 1 JAN. 80 IS $0.10 PER POUND. ZINC SMELTER OP CHARGE ( 1/80) IS $180.00/MT CONC. LEAD SMELTER OP CHARGE (1979) IS $94.62/MT CONC. COPPER REFINERY OP CHARGE (1/80) IS $0.065/LB CU. LEAD REFINERY OP CHARGE (1979) IS $154.83/MT CONC. LEAD AND ZINC CONCENTRATES ARE ASSUMED TO BE SENT TO THE SULFIDE CORP. PTY. LTD. (CRA) AT BOOLAROO,NEW SOUTH WALES BY RAIL A DISTANCE OF APPROX. 800KM.
